In the forests and gardens of the Americas, a Harvard researcher named Patrick McKenzie has turned his attention to one of evolution's quieter masterpieces: the bond between hummingbirds and red flowers. What looks like a bird simply feeding is, in truth, a millions-of-years-old conversation between two species, each having shaped the other through the patient pressure of survival. McKenzie's work reminds us that beauty in nature is rarely ornamental — it is functional, reciprocal, and deeply fragile.
